What is a cat speed boat?

A catamaran (/ˌkætəməˈræn/) (informally, a cat) is a watercraft with two parallel hulls of equal size. The wide distance between a catamaran’s hulls imparts stability through resistance to rolling and overturning; no ballast is required. Catamarans, with their dual-hulled structure, inherently offer greater stability on the water than traditional single-hulled yachts. With so many different types of boats, you can’t give a blanket price on “boats” in general.The “10% Rule” is a common guideline that suggests you budget around 10% of your yacht’s purchase price per year for running costs and maintenance . In plain English: a yacht that cost $500,000 might cost roughly $50,000 each year to own and operate.The most significant upfront cost in boat ownership is the initial price of the boat itself.
